#0a52fe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0a52fe is composed of 3.9% red, 32.2%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.1% cyan, 67.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 222.3 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 51.8%. #0a52fe color hex could be obtained by blending #14a4ff with #0000fd. Closest websafe color is: #0066ff.

#0a52fe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0a52fe has RGB values of R:10, G:82,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0.68,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 676606.

Shades and Tints of #0a52fe
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000309 is the darkest color, while #f4f8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0a52fe
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c818c is the less saturated color, while #0a52fe is the most saturated one.
